Charvin Cotes-du-Rhone Rose

Vintage: 2018
Description: Gerard Charvin and his son, Laurent, represent the quintessence of the small domaine/father and son team. They have only 8 Ha of Cha?teauneuf-duPape, and half of that they sell off to negociants, keeping only the best lots for the Cha?teauneuf of Domaine Charvin. Average 40 years Sandy, more clay based soil with galets roulés A 1.5 ha parcel of about (depending on the crop variation each year) 50% Grenache, 50% Cinsaul. Organically farmed and entirely harvested by hand with sorting done in the vineyard. The Cinsault is first harvested and pressed and then about a day later the Grenache is harvested and pressed. Once assembled, they ferment for 14 days with only indigenous yeasts. After racking, this rosé spends the winter in tanks, conducting a natural sedimentation and is finally bottled in April.
